
In today’s digital age, a website or submission’s user experience is more crucial than ever. with the rise of online interactions, users expect a seamless and flawless experience when interacting with digital products. Web development testing is a critical step in ensuring that your website or application meets these expectations. In this comprehensive guide, we’ll delve into the world of web development testing, exploring its benefits, best practices, and practical tips for unlocking flawless user experiences.
What is web Development Testing?
Web development testing,also known as web application testing,is the process of evaluating a website or application’s functionality,performance,and usability to identify defects,bugs,and areas for improvement. This testing process involves a series of steps, including:
- Unit testing: Testing individual components or units of code to ensure they function as expected
- Integration testing: Testing how different components or units interact with each other
- System testing: Testing the entire system, including all components and integrations
- Acceptance testing: Testing the system to ensure it meets the required specifications and standards
Benefits of Web Development Testing
Web development testing offers numerous benefits, including:
- Improved user experience: By identifying and fixing defects, you can ensure a seamless and intuitive user experience
- Increased conversion rates: A well-tested website or application can lead to higher conversion rates and revenue
- Enhanced credibility: A bug-free and functional website or application can enhance your brand’s credibility and reputation
- Reduced maintenance costs: Identifying and fixing defects early on can reduce maintenance costs and minimize downtime
Practical Tips for Web Development Testing
To ensure effective web development testing, follow these practical tips:
- Test early and often: Test your website or application regularly, starting from the development phase
- Use automated testing tools: Leverage automated testing tools to streamline the testing process and reduce manual effort
- Conduct user testing: Conduct user testing to gather feedback and insights on the user experience
- Test for accessibility: Test your website or application for accessibility to ensure it’s usable by all users, including those with disabilities
Case Studies: Real-World Examples of Web Development Testing
Let’s take a look at some real-world examples of web development testing in action:
Case Study | Testing Approach | Results |
---|---|---|
Amazon | Automated testing and user testing | Improved user experience, increased conversion rates, and reduced defects |
Continuous testing and integration | Faster time-to-market, reduced downtime, and improved overall quality | |
Automated testing and testing for accessibility | Improved user experience, increased accessibility, and reduced defects |
First-Hand Experience: Lessons Learned from Web Development Testing
As a seasoned developer, I’ve learned the importance of web development testing through hands-on experience. One of the most important lessons I’ve learned is the importance of testing early and often. By testing regularly, you can catch defects and issues early on, reducing the overall cost and effort required to fix them.
Another key takeaway is the value of automated testing tools. These tools can streamline the testing process,reducing manual effort and freeing up time for more strategic and creative work.
Conclusion
web development testing is a critical step in ensuring a flawless user experience. By understanding the benefits, best practices, and practical tips outlined in this guide, you can unlock a seamless and intuitive user experience that drives engagement, conversion, and revenue. Remember to test early and frequently enough,leverage automated testing tools,and conduct user testing to gather feedback and insights. With web development testing, you can ensure your website or application meets the highest standards of quality, usability, and accessibility, setting your business up for success in the digital age.